This companion is the first book of its kind to focus on the whole
of European Romanticism.
Describes the way in which the Romantic Movement swept across
Europe in the early nineteenth century.
Covers the national literatures of France, Germany, Italy, Poland,
Russia and Spain.
Addresses common themes that cross national borders, such as
orientalism, Napoleon, night, nature, and the prestige of the
fragment.
Includes cross-disciplinary essays on literature and music,
literature and painting, and the general system of Romantic
arts.
Features 35 essays in all, from leading scholars in America,
Australia, Britain, France, Italy, and Switzerland.
